Chapter 140 - Chapter 140: The Arrival of the Soul Hall

Holy Pill City, Pill Tower

Within a spacious courtyard, a towering Violet-Gold Lion King lounged lazily at the entrance. Its gleaming violet-gold fur shimmered with a faint, ghostly luster, while its amethyst eyes—each the size of a lantern—swept its surroundings with an imposing vigilance.

Not far off, pedestrians passing by the nearby road couldn't help but scatter in alarm at the sight, instinctively distancing themselves.

Seeing this, the Violet-Gold Lion King appeared quite pleased with itself. It casually tossed an Eight-Marked Blood Vitality Pill into its mouth and began to digest it slowly.

A surge of powerful blood essence burst forth—less intense than what a Nine-Marked Pill would yield, but still visibly strengthening its body at a remarkable pace.

It had already been three months since the Violet-Gold Lion King arrived here. The memory of that initial encounter at the trial pill event was still vivid in its mind.

"Interested in joining me in the future?"

"Is food, lodging, and alchemical pills included?"

"All you can eat."

"Alright, I'm in."

Such a simple exchange had paved the way for its current, idyllic lifestyle. Thinking back on it now, the Violet-Gold Lion King couldn't help but feel it had struck gold.

Whoosh—

A figure landed at the edge of the courtyard—a young man approached, clearly wary of the beast's enormous form, yet summoning the courage to draw closer.

"My clan leader wishes to request an audien—"

"Scram. The master is in seclusion. No time."

Before the youth could even finish his sentence, the Violet-Gold Lion King rose to its full, terrifying height. A powerful pressure erupted from its body, crashing down upon the boy like a tidal wave.

In the span of three months, the Lion King had advanced from a newly ascended Dou Ancestor to a One-Star Dou Venerate, thanks to the lavish supply of pills and Origin Stones poured on it by Chen Xiaoming.

That crushing Dou Venerate aura overwhelmed the youth in an instant, knocking him unconscious. With a disdainful grunt, the lion casually tossed him off to the side.

It had lost count of how many such overconfident people had tried to gain an audience. Ever since Chen Xiaoming advanced to the Imperial Soul Realm and refined a Nine-Marked Blood Vitality Pill, people had been flocking to him like moths to flame.

The Violet-Gold Lion King had been stationed at the gate as the guardian. Anyone whose cultivation was weaker than his wasn't even allowed through the door.

Combat was forbidden in Holy Pill City, but with his strength, those stronger than him could be persuaded to retreat. The weaker ones? Just a little pressure, knock them out, and someone would eventually come clean up the mess.

"Sigh… Wonder when the master will come out of seclusion."

The Lion King heaved a dramatic sigh. Though now a fearsome Dou Venerate, it lay humbly by the courtyard gate, its eyes filled not with resentment—but nostalgia.

Don't get the wrong idea—this beast's preferences were entirely normal. It had no untoward interest in Chen Xiaoming's body—just in the alchemy pills he had promised.

So long as it got pills, the Violet-Gold Lion King would do anything!

Just then, a few more figures flew in from the distance. The lion narrowed its gaze, standing tall again and preparing to "greet" them in its own special way.

Inside the courtyard—

Chen Xiaoming was lounging contentedly, savoring a moment of peace. Beside him, Xiao Xun'er dutifully sliced various spiritual fruits and offered them to him like a gentle disciple.

"Disciple, tell me—should your master start his own force?"

His sudden question caught Xiao Xun'er off guard. She looked at him, puzzled, not understanding why he would suddenly consider such a thing.

Chen Xiaoming stared thoughtfully at the skies above Holy Pill City. The Doupo Plane was saturated with warring factions, but with his current power and alchemical mastery, creating a force of his own would be laughably easy.

Xiao Xun'er could not inherit his Dao. But maybe others could.

Truthfully, the idea had first taken root when he helped the Violet-Gold Lion King ascend to Dou Venerate.

The system's method for upgrading pill inscriptions was terrifyingly efficient. It gave him the power to mass-produce strong cultivators.

The cost wasn't even high. Whether he stayed in Holy Pill City or went adventuring, he still drew breath the same way.

He hadn't come all this way just to hide and lay low. That wasn't the style of Chen Xiaoming.

He was here to make waves.

"Pack up. We're heading out tomorrow."

"You're leaving?"

When news broke that Chen Xiaoming was leaving, Xuan Kongzi and the others came to see him off. During his stay at the Pill Tower, he had humiliated every other alchemist there—without exception.

Even the oldest veterans couldn't do anything about him.

"Yeah. Planning to tour other parts of Central Plains."

His tone was light as his eyes swept across a few grim-faced elders behind Xuan Kongzi. With an awkward cough, Chen Xiaoming decided to skip pleasantries. He simply took Xiao Xun'er and the Violet-Gold Lion King and left.

"Whew, finally gone."

Stepping into the spatial wormhole, Chen Xiaoming sighed in relief. Those elders had terrifyingly intense glares.

What? Just because he'd sparred with them a little in alchemy, they had to hold a grudge?

Wasn't it normal for alchemists to share pill formulas? He even shared the recipe for the Kidney Boost Pill! And he didn't complain!

Yet those old geezers, after realizing what that pill could do, had their faces twisted with complex expressions… tsk tsk, Chen Xiaoming didn't even dare bring it up.

"Teacher, where are we going?"

Xiao Xun'er had no idea what had transpired and asked curiously.

Breaking free from those cranky old men, Chen Xiaoming gazed through the spatial tunnel, vision settling on a unique location—a perfect place to begin.

"We're heading to the Heavenly Star Mountain Range."

...

Half a month later, Central Plains's inner region—

"Teacher, we'll reach the southern region soon."

They had spent half a month meandering south, mostly because Chen Xiaoming insisted on sightseeing and taking detours.

Ahead lay a massive mountain range. Once crossed, it would bring them into Central Plains's Southern Region.

As for how Xiao Xun'er became so familiar with the geography? All thanks to her handling the navigation.

Chen Xiaoming couldn't be bothered with maps. The Violet-Gold Lion King? Completely clueless—it had been stuck in Holy Pill City the whole time playing with pills. The task of finding the way naturally fell to Xiao Xun'er.

"Mhm."

Chen Xiaoming nodded absentmindedly but suddenly stopped walking. His eyes scanned the peaceful, picturesque mountains ahead.

"Teacher?"

Before she could finish asking, Chen Xiaoming had pulled Xiao Xun'er aside and tossed her onto the Violet-Gold Lion King's back.

"Take her ahead. Wait for me there."

The lion nodded without question and bolted off with Xiao Xun'er in tow.

Watching them go, Chen Xiaoming nodded in satisfaction.

That's the kind of straightforward nature I like.

He turned slowly, his gaze drifting toward the void behind him. A smile tugged at the corner of his lips.

"Still not coming out? You've been tailing me the whole way."
